Abstract

Malaria is a kind of disease detrimental to human health and plasmodium is a critical pathogen in it. The immunity against foreign antigens including plasmodium could be divided into two categories, namely, adaptive immunity and innate im-munity. Innate immunity induces non-specific immune response, and is composed of monocyte,macrophage,γδT cell,DC,NK, and cytokines etc. Innate immunity cooperates with adaptive im-munity efficiently to protect against malaria. Meanwhile,autoph-agy is not only the cellular degrading process, but also gets in-volved in regulating immune system and defending against plas-modium infection. Therefore, elucidation of corresponding mechanism could provide proof for efficiently controlling and cu-ring malaria,developing related medicine and vaccine,and clin-ical treatment as well. This article reviews the constitution of in-nate immunity in malaria,related regulation mechanism and rel-evant therapeutic targets for it.
